/** * Identify whether an event date and a year, month, and day are consistent, where consistent * means that either the eventDate is a single day and the year-month-day represent the same day * or that eventDate is a date range that defines the same date range as year-month (where day is * null) or the same date range as year (where day and month are null). If all of eventDate, * year, month, and day are null or empty, then returns true. If eventDate specifies an interval * of more than one day and day is specified, then result is true if the day is the first day of the * interval. If eventDate is not null and year, month, and day are, then result is false (data is * not consistent with no data).// www .jav a2 s . c o m * * Provides: EVENTDATE_CONSISTENT_WITH_DAY_MONTH_YEAR * * @param eventDate dwc:eventDate * @param year dwc:year * @param month dwc:month * @param day dwc:day * * @return true if eventDate is consistent with year-month-day. */ public static boolean isConsistent(String eventDate, String year, String month, String day) { boolean result = false; StringBuffer date = new StringBuffer(); if (!isEmpty(eventDate)) { if (!isEmpty(year) && !isEmpty(month) && !isEmpty(day)) { date.append(year).append("-").append(month).append("-").append(day); if (!isRange(eventDate)) { DateMidnight eventDateDate = extractDate(eventDate); DateMidnight bitsDate = extractDate(date.toString()); if (eventDateDate != null && bitsDate != null) { if (eventDateDate.year().compareTo(bitsDate) == 0 && eventDateDate.monthOfYear().compareTo(bitsDate) == 0 && eventDateDate.dayOfMonth().compareTo(bitsDate) == 0) { result = true; } } } else { Interval eventDateDate = extractDateInterval(eventDate); DateMidnight bitsDate = extractDate(date.toString()); if (eventDateDate != null && bitsDate != null) { if (eventDateDate.getStart().year().compareTo(bitsDate) == 0 && eventDateDate.getStart().monthOfYear().compareTo(bitsDate) == 0 && eventDateDate.getStart().dayOfMonth().compareTo(bitsDate) == 0) { result = true; } } } } if (!isEmpty(year) && !isEmpty(month) && isEmpty(day)) { date.append(year).append("-").append(month); Interval eventDateInterval = extractDateInterval(eventDate); Interval bitsInterval = extractDateInterval(date.toString()); if (eventDateInterval.equals(bitsInterval)) { result = true; } } if (!isEmpty(year) && isEmpty(month) && isEmpty(day)) { date.append(year); Interval eventDateInterval = extractDateInterval(eventDate); Interval bitsInterval = extractDateInterval(date.toString()); if (eventDateInterval.equals(bitsInterval)) { result = true; } } } else { if (isEmpty(year) && isEmpty(month) && isEmpty(day)) { // eventDate, year, month, and day are all empty, treat as consistent. result = true; } } return result; }
